Transaction 66784c1bde50eef2b9122920f4a4d4c58e42dd03cf53cdb65f80c35a7fde637b
1 Input
1 Output
-
66784c1bde50eef2b9122920f4a4d4c58e42dd03cf53cdb65f80c35a7fde637b:0
- value
- 308613
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 770977ec34d6a420aa811da3936575817b3b5381 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BrQki1kKAvVPmC1CKbbhLaXDEbyERX8yH